Recently, the Chinese government cracked down on operations in the country. With China hosting the world’s largest fraction of Bitcoin’s mining capacity, this sent shockwaves through the network and had a huge effect in multiple ways. Here is what is going on.

A graph showing the wild fluctuations in Bitcoin mining in various provinces of China. Source: CBECI

Chinese authorities have ordered miners in the Sichuan region and elsewhere to shut down, while ordering local authorities to shut off power to mining operations. Banks have also been instructed to close accounts or halt transactions suspected of being linked to cryptocurrency operations. With the ability to strike and make decisions in a way that is generally not possible in most democracies, the move has been swift and decisive.

Whispers from the changing political winds around Bitcoin have slowed investment in additional capacity for Chinese miners for some time. Before the move, Chinese mining operations accounted for between 60 and 75.5% of Bitcoin’s global hashrate. According to the Cambridge Bitcoin Energy Consumption Index (CBECI), however, the number quickly dropped to just 46%.

With many huge offline mining operations, the power consumption of the Bitcoin network has dropped significantly. At the time, Bitcoin was using around 15 GW 24 hours a day, for an estimated annual consumption of around 129 TWh over a full year. However, as it stands, the CBECI now measures Bitcoin as using only 11.92 GW for an estimated annual consumption of 87.3 TWh, which rebounded from a low of nearly 10 GW earlier. this month.

This is a huge drop and indicates how much the extraction capacity has been disconnected. This also has effects on the functioning of the Bitcoin network. With less hash of miners, it takes more time for miners to find solutions to resolve Bitcoin blocks. The mining difficulty is automatically modified by the Bitcoin algorithm every 2,016 blocks, based on the current hashrates, in order to maintain a block resolution time of approximately 10 minutes. Under normal conditions, this happens about every two weeks. However, with the sudden huge drop in the loss of Chinese miners, block resolution times dropped to 14-19 minutes until the algorithm made a correction on July 3. The difficulty of mining has become 28% easier, a historically significant drop for the cryptocurrency.

This is good news for current miners, who will share the spoils of their efforts with a much smaller group of participants. This should last at least until Chinese operations are operational in other jurisdictions (which may help explain August’s rise). However, it is next door to China and has cheap electricity, so many miners have moved their operations there. The United States is also a popular choice for its lack of organized political opposition to Bitcoin, cheap energy, and ease of doing business.

The decrease in energy consumption from 15 GW to 10 GW was significant, marking a decrease of 33%. At its recent low point, instantaneous consumption had fallen even lower, around 50% of peak. If we take the current number, we can do some calculations on the effect on emissions. The US Energy Information Administration cites a figure of about 0.92 lbs of CO2 emissions per kWh of energy produced in the United States in 2019. Using that rough figure, China’s decision eliminated 18 million metric tons of CO2 emissions in just a few weeks. That’s roughly the equivalent of taking 3.9 million cars off the road, according to an EPA calculator.
